The height of the fascia is not matching up in the side elevation. However,

the front elevation shows them to be at the same height. I checked the roof and all the slope segments are set at 5/12 and the overhang is set at 2' for all segments.

Hi,

it looks to me that your elevation symbol actually cuts the roof (elevation is actually a special kind of section).

Try to move elevation symbol and it's cutting line away from the roof (away from the building) and check elevation again.

Your elevation view cut line is closer to the building than your roof overhang. Move it further away from the building.
